End of Year Report for 1 October 1984 through 30 September 1985 for Contract Number N00014-84-K-0289,

Abstract

This document contains summaries of papers on the following topics: Mechanical vs Electrical Relaxation in AgI-based Fast Ion Conducting Glasses; Ambient Temperature Plastic Crystal Fast Ion Conductors (PLICFICS); All-Halide Superionic Glasses; Mechanical Relaxation by Mobile Ions Cu(+) and Ag(+) in Fast Ion Conducting Glasses; Recent Developments in Fast Ion Transport in Glassy and Amorphous Materials; Silver Alkali Halide Glasses and a Vitreous Analog of the RbAg4I5 Superionic Conductor; Fast Ion Phenomenology in Glassy Solids, Transport in Solids; and Recent Developments in Fast Ion Transport in Glassy and Amorphous Materials.
